Step-by-step analysis walkthrough
Use this when you own Analog Supply Noise during an AMS war room.
Capture failing mode and environmental condition.
Pull synchronized waveform, logs, and report artifacts.
Mark first boundary where legal behavior diverges.
Audit reset/clock/power sequence assumptions.
Check physical coupling contributors (floorplan/power/package) where relevant.
Assign single-thread ownership for the first fix.
Propose bounded change and define success criterion.
Run scenario and safety regressions.
Document findings in closure memo.
Update signoff dashboard and waiver state.

Key takeaways
State boundary, mode, and evidence tag with every claim.
Always align analog, digital, and physical owners before signoff decisions.
Common pitfalls
Fixing averages while tails still fail.
Skipping package/supply evidence in jitter or SerDes issues.
Shipping with waivers that lack owner and expiration criteria.
Principal AMS review addendum
Switching current bursts from digital domains couple through shared impedance and package parasitics, modulating analog supply quality and phase noise.
